Document Transport — Safe Lock Replacement (Records Wing)

Quick notes on shipping the replacement lock for the records-wing safe. The unit from Marlowe Lockworks arrives pre-configured, so it travels in its sealed factory box — don't open it to "check," that voids the config. Keep it in the locked cupboard until collection day, and log it in the transit ledger like any restricted item. Greyfen Couriers handles the run to the Oakhampton office. At pickup, give the courier this instruction:

handover note for kagep-kagup: the holok holdor courier leaves the rusix sorox fenwyn ledger at gate 3590 under passcode 092644

Subject: Canary gating tweaks for Driftpoint 5.1

Hi all — heads up for our security reviewer: canaries now require two green synthetic runs plus a clean dependency scan before auto-promotion. Manual override still exists but pages the on-call, so use sparingly. Rules live in the Fernlake config repo. The gated canary currently running carries the trace token below.

build token for kajeg-bageg: htk6_abeb3e

Ticket: Staging env misconfigured for Siftgate bloom filter

The bloom layer in front of the Pellet KV store is rejecting all lookups in staging because the env file was copied from the dev template without credentials. False-positive tuning values are fine; only the auth line is missing. To unblock the weekly demo, the Pellet admission secret must be set on the following line.

env line for yaguf-fajop: LEDGER_TOKEN13=fb08984397349

Subject: Receipt mailer cut-over — done!

Hi all, quick recap for the newer folks. Over the weekend we moved the donation-receipt mailer off the old Pelwick queue and onto the Larkbine sender. All pending receipts drained cleanly, and Monday's batch went out on the new path without a hiccup. Templates are unchanged, so donors shouldn't notice anything. If you're debugging send issues, check the worker logs first, then the retry table. The new service runs with the following settings.

config for fawig-fajep:
[ulaael]
team = istion
access_code = ac_12ee45
host = ulaael.olvarqnet.local
port = 7000
owner = eliiel.ulaath
peer = holdor.torvagrid.example